The free virtual conference will also include networking opportunities, workshops, and skillshares. The event will also feature a variety of Eventbrite creators, including Radha Agrawal, co-founder and CEO of DAYBREAKER Nora Abousteit, founder of CraftJam and Lyndal Reed, head of strategy and operations for The Guardian Live. The summit will also feature expert talks from industry leaders such as Dayna Frank, board president and co-founder of National Independent Venue Association (NIVA) (CelebrityAccess) - Ticketing and event platform Eventbrite announced Reconvene, a free online seminar for independent content creators about creating live events in the era of COVID-19.įeatured speakers lined up for the virtual conference include Priya Parker, the best-selling author of The Art of Gathering: How We Meet and Why it Matters and the host of The New York Times podcast, “Together Apart” and Bob Wachter, chair of the Department of Medicine at UCSF and guest host of the “In the Bubble” podcast.
